Description

  • Design, develop, implement, and integrate Information Assurance (IA) and security systems and system components, including those for networking, computing, and enclave environments with differing data protection/classification requirements.

  • Integrate Information Assurance (IA) directly into systems deployed to operational environments.

  • Assist architects and system developers in identifying and implementing appropriate information security functionality to ensure uniform application of Agency security policy and enterprise solutions.

  • Support the development and construction of security architectures.

  • Enforce the design and implementation of trusted relationships among external systems and architectures.

  • Assess and mitigate system security threats and risks throughout the program life cycle.

  • Contribute to security planning, assessment, risk analysis, risk management, certification, and awareness activities for system and networking operations.

  • Review certification and accreditation (C&A) documentation, providing feedback on completeness and compliance of its content.

  • Apply system security engineering expertise across areas including: system security design process; engineering life cycle; information domain; cross-domain solutions; commercial and government off-the-shelf cryptography; identification, authentication, and authorization; system integration; risk management; intrusion detection; contingency planning; incident handling; configuration control; change management; auditing; certification and accreditation processes; principles of IA (confidentiality, integrity, non-repudiation, availability, and access control); and security testing.

  • Support security authorization activities, ensuring compliance with NSA/CSS Information System Certification and Accreditation Process (NISCAP), DoD Risk Management Framework (RMF), NIST Risk Management Framework (RMF) processes, and prescribed NSA/CSS business processes for security engineering.
